Output 13560da0751025d81cb1552a4d95e98add9c4366d32010c07d842e44902d4155:20

value
984999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9e8df577c41f5eb8be58c2947329ea6f088187 OP_EQUAL
address
3HX2mHtnFmScQvv1apqe58AKPLkidhhKtz
transaction
13560da0751025d81cb1552a4d95e98add9c4366d32010c07d842e44902d4155
confirmations
274405
spent
true